In this delightful sequel to Who Stole the Gold?, Ferret finds some delicious raspberries. This book contains valuable lessons about jumping to conclusions, prejudice, and defending your honor. Children will enjoy the bright, colorful illustrations and the animals' lively dialogue. Ages 5-8.
